Describe a new skill you learned that you think is important

You should say:

  • What it is

  • Whether it is difficult or not

  • How you learned it

 And explain why you think it is important

IELTS Speaking sample: 

I’m going to talk about cooking which is a practical skill that we use almost every day. 

It may sound strange as a lot of people learned how to cook when they were still teenagers. But to be honest, I hadn’t been able to cook until my grandma talked me into learning it, and I started to learn this skill with her just two months ago.

My grandma is very good at cooking and is the main cook in my family. She can cook many Vietnamese dishes, and her specialty is curry, which is also my favorite. 

Honestly, I’m quite hopeless when it comes to cooking. It took me around 2 weeks to use the knife properly and make a sunny-side-up egg. However, I made good progress. I learned some basic cooking practices, and now I can cook some simple dishes such as some kinds of soup, omelette and fried rice. Sadly, due to my busy work schedule, I can only practice cooking with my grandma on weekends when we prepare meals for my family.

I used to think that cooking is kind of a burden, and there are plenty of places where we can buy food. But now, I completely changed my mind. I find that learning how to cook is extremely useful, as this skill is extremely beneficial to our life. Cooking by ourselves allows us to have better control of our nutrition, which is essential to maintaining a balanced diet and staying healthy.

Từ vựng trong IELTS Speaking sample:

1.A specialty /ˈspeʃ.əl.ti/: đặc sản

Ví dụ: Oysters are a local specialty of the area.

2.A sunny-side-up egg /ˈsʌn.i/ /saɪd/ /ʌp/ /eɡ/: trứng ốp la một mặt

Ví dụ: Add some chunks of fried potatoes, topped with a sunny side up fried egg.

3.To make good progress: có tiến bộ tốt

Progress  /ˈprəʊ.ɡres/: tiến triển, tiến bộ

Ví dụ: The doctor said that she was making good progress.

4.Burden /ˈbɜː.dən/: gánh nặng

Ví dụ: I don’t want to be a burden on my children.

5.Nutrition /njuːˈtrɪʃ.ən/: dinh dưỡng

Ví dụ: Good nutrition is essential if patients are to make a quick recovery.

6.A balanced diet /ˌbæl.ənst ˈdaɪ.ət/: chế độ ăn cân bằng

Diet / ˈdaɪ.ət/: chế độ ăn

Balance /ˌbæl.əns/: cân bằng

Ví dụ: If you have a balanced diet, you are getting all the vitamins you need.

 IELTS Speaking Part 3 Sample

  • What skills are important for a businessperson to succeed?

Gợi ý: planning skills (kỹ năng lên kế hoạch), teamwork skills (kỹ năng làm việc nhóm), collaborate (cộng tác, phối hợp), productivity (năng suất)

First, managers are required to have excellent planning skills, which help companies to set their goals and make plans to achieve these goals. On the other hand, good teamwork skills of employees are another contributor to the success of an organization. Only when workers in a company collaborate effectively with each other will work productivity increase significantly.

  • What is the difference between required skills in the past and those at present?

Gợi ý: time (thời đại), Stone Age (thời kỳ đồ đá), survive (sống sót), industrial revolution (cuộc cách mạng công nghiệp), mechanical skills (kỹ năng về cơ khí), human interaction (sự tương tác giữa người với người), interpersonal skills (kỹ năng xã hội

In different times, people are required to have different sets of skills.

During the Stone Age, people needed skills such as hunting or food-gathering to survive in the harsh living condition.

After the industrial revolution, workers were expected to work in factories and handle machines, so mechanical skills were the most essential skills during this period.

Nowadays, I think because human interaction and cooperation are highly promoted in the world of business, people place greater importance on interpersonal skills.

  • What kinds of skills should successful people have?

Gợi ý: expertise (chuyên môn), technical skills (kỹ năng kỹ thuật), communication skills (kỹ năng giao tiếp), build relationships (xây dựng các mối quan hệ), increase productivity (tăng năng suất)

The most important skill is having higher level of expertise. Without the technical skills to perform their tasks, other soft skills are just meaningless. Another skill that plays a significant role in achieving success is communication skills. When working, workers need to collaborate with their customers, managers and coworkers, so having good communication skills enables employees to build good relationships and increase their productivity.
